re: I don't understand what PWAs have to do with Node.js. Node.js is not a PWA requirement. The only requirement is a manifest.json and a service worker.

Some hybrid web apps run node processes and too many node processes running at once takes too many resources.

Building a native application will most likely be more performant than hybrid app.

If engineers can port iPad app to MacOS this is a better option than building a hybrid app for MacOS (when developer resources are available to do so) IMHO.


It is not possible for a PWA to start a node process. Maybe you are confusing them with electron apps?

Iā€™m using the term kinda loosely. Edited above article for clarity.

